Environmental Studies & Earth Sciences programmes offer a comprehensive understanding of ecological systems, sustainability, and earth processes. For those considering these fields, tuition fees can vary widely. The lower-end tuition fee, represented by the €1,216, offers an accessible entry point for students. Meanwhile, the typical tuition fee, denoted by the €19,090, provides a benchmark for what most students might expect to pay. On the higher end, the €45,218 reflects the cost for premium programmes or institutions. It's encouraging to note that a significant 10% of programmes fall within a budget-friendly range, making these fields accessible to a broader audience. Additionally, the growing trend of online learning is evident, with a 12% of Environmental Studies & Earth Sciences programmes now available online, offering flexibility for students worldwide.

Professional Engineering Geology
The Professional Engineering Geology course from University of Canterbury is the only programme of its kind in Australasia. Engineering Geology is a multidisciplinary area applying geological sciences to engineering work, identifying and mitigating geological hazards, and aspects of land-use planning.
